My family loves going to Umai; however, I'm usually busy when they go, so I finally got to go with them. The food was amazing! I'm usually skeptical of going to sushi places, outside of AYCE, but I got their katsu don and it was delicious! It had crispy pork, egg, mushroom, and tons of flavor. We also got individual nigiri pieces, and they were so fresh. My katsu don came with miso soup and a salad as well; both tasted very fresh. The service was very good. They always checked up on us and made sure our drinks were filled. The ambiance was very clean and looked fancy. I love how you can see the chefs prepare the sushi as well!

We came late on a cold weekday and the food hit the spot! It was about 9p and there was still plenty of people. We called ahead just in case but they said reservations are only accepted for parties of 6 or more. We still were seated quickly. We got some ika karaage and white truffle roll to start and also ordered katsu kare and tsukemen both with extra egg. Food came quick! Both the noodles and katsu were "dry" but that was what the sauce is for! The Yelp page said no Apple Pay but they were able to accept at the front.

Gilt Bar has been a Chicago favorite since 2010, and after my first visit I understand why…read more The space is dark, energetic, and packed with personality. This is not the place for a quiet conversation. It may be one of the loudest restaurants I've visited in quite some time, and a nearby birthday celebration only added to the energy. That said, the atmosphere is part of the appeal. If you're looking for a fun, celebratory evening with friends or family, Gilt Bar delivers. I can't imagine choosing it for a business dinner. We started with the Tenderloin Steak Tartare and onion rings. Both were excellent. My daughter was craving the Bolognese, while I ordered the vodka rigatoni. The portions were generous, and both dishes were flavorful and satisfying. The truffle mafaldine appears to be the menu's most celebrated pasta and receives plenty of attention on Yelp, but we were very happy with our selections. Service was spot on throughout the evening. Food arrived with good pacing, drinks were refreshed promptly, and our server struck the right balance between attentive and intrusive. For dessert, we shared the gooey skillet cookie. Be warned: this thing arrives at the table with nuclear-level heat. The vanilla ice cream isn't just there for flavor, it's there for protection. One unusual observation: the floors seemed surprisingly slippery throughout the restaurant, something we noticed more than once. Our bill came to $159 before tip, which felt reasonable given the quality of the food, service, and overall experience. Between the lively atmosphere, strong food, excellent service, and vibrant bar scene, it's easy to understand why Gilt Bar has remained popular for more than 15 years
